Handover note — Inventory write-down, Velstrom Components

Taking over from Dorian as of Monday. The Q3 write-down on the Kestrel valve line is mostly booked; roughly 40% of the aged stock at the Fennmouth warehouse remains unvalued. Auditors from Calloway & Pryce want supporting schedules by month-end. Finance should prioritise the reconciliation before anything else. Context for the decision is summarised in the confidential note below.

confidential, bahof-yaweg: Headcount on the Kaseth team goes from 32 to 109 by the end of January. Gross margin on Kaseth came in at 46 percent against a plan of 45 percent.

## Further Reading

So you've made it through the basics of Stormlark, our weather-alert fan-out service. Nice. The short version: alerts come in from the Nimbus feed, get deduped, then fan out to every subscriber channel within a few seconds. The tricky parts are retry semantics and the regional sharding logic, which trip up almost everyone at first. Before you touch the dispatcher code, skim the architecture notes the Pelting team wrote last quarter. You'll find the full internal deep-dive here.

wiki page, tahaf-tajog: https://jira.ordindyn.corp/pipeline

Memo: Loyalty Programme Overhaul — Heads of Department

The Silvermark loyalty scheme will be replaced with a tiered points model developed with Quenby Analytics. Migration of member balances begins next quarter, with branch pilots in Aldermoor first. Department heads should nominate transition leads by Monday. Full rationale and timing appear in the plan below.

management briefing: The renewal with Zoraelax Group closes at $10 million a year, 15 percent below the last contract. Project Ralael slips by six weeks because of the audit delay.

Account Recovery — Pagewright Static Builds

If a customer loses access to their Pagewright dashboard, incremental rebuilds of their static site will continue from the last known-good deploy, so no content is lost during recovery. Confirm the customer's last rebuild timestamp in the Orlin console, then initiate the recovery flow from the admin panel. Do not trigger a full rebuild until access is restored. Unlocking the recovery flow requires the passphrase below.

recovery phrase for yadup-taguf: wenael-quenox-kelix